Why do fables have moral or lesson? .How do fables help you learn better?​

Respuesta :

gracieg200674 gracieg200674
  • 03-09-2022
Fables were originally folklore used to teach people lessons between good and bad. Fables can help you learn better because they exaggerate a character’s good or bad qualities making it easier to understand the lesson.
